Rosemary Aitken
The Silent Shore

In the sequel to Stormy Waters, a startling revelation leads Sprat Nicholls to break off with her childhood sweetheart, Denzil Vargo, and quarrel with her family. Determined to get as far away as possible from her native Cornwall, Sprat moves 300 miles away to London. On the surface everything seems perfect, but the stifling atmosphere of the city streets soon have her longing for home and for the bewildered Denzil, who has no idea why he and Sprat can never be together.

A lovely evocation of a bygone era, with lively characters and an exciting conclusion.

'Aitken not only skillfully animates an intriguing setting, but she also fashions a cliff-hanger'- Booklist

 

 

Michael Chabon
The Final Solution

In deep retirement in the English countryside, an eighty-nine-year-old man, vaguely recollected by locals as a once-famous detective, is more concerned with his beekeeping than with his fellow man. Into his life wanders Linus Steinman, nine years old and mute, who has escaped from Nazi Germany with his sole companion: an African grey parrot. What is the meaning of the mysterious strings of German numbers the bird spews out? A top-secret SS code? The keys to a series of Swiss bank accounts, perhaps? Or something more sinister?

'It takes a steady hand to appropriate the world's most famous detective, but Chabon has chutzpah to spare'- INDEPENDENT

Ian McEwan  
Black Dogs

In 1946, a young couple set off on their honeymoon. Fired by their ideals and passion for one another, they plan an idyllic holiday. But in a gorge in the mountains of southern France they encounter a vision of evil in the shape of two black dogs - an experience of darkness so terrifying it alters their lives forever.

'Compassionate without resorting to sentimentality, clever without ever losing its honesty . . . Ian McEwan's most human work'- TIMES LITERARY SUPPLEMENT

'I judge it his best yet, which I should make clear is saying a great deal'- OBSERVER

'Brilliant . . . a meditation on the intoxications of violence and the redemptive power of love'- NEW YORKER
